    This is a model that I would like to use to get feedback on model cleanup techniques. Being designed for animation rather than 3d printing, there are bunches of protruding triangles, self-intersecting triangles, possibly some faces oriented the wrong way, maybe holes too. Share your techniques to allow mesh-newbies to making this (and other objects) printable. For fun, I tried slicing and printing it, but skeinforge was complaining all the way. It actually printed fairly well considering - the main problem was that somewhere near the top skeinforge decided to stop creating infill, so the top of the back and hindquarters had no support as they were closing over.
